Explanation
All the listed behaviors are signs of impaired driving. These behaviors can put the driver and other road users at risk of accidents, injuries, and even fatalities. Driving slower than the normal flow of traffic can be an indication of a driver's reduced reflexes and judgment. Sudden stops can be an indication of impaired perception and decision-making abilities. Weaving between lanes can be an indication of a driver's inability to maintain a steady course on the road.
